About The Position

As Saab, Inc. is getting ready to begin our manufacturing operation in Grayling, MI we are seeking a Lead Material Handler to join our team! The Lead Material Handler will be an integral link between manufacturing, engineering, supply chain, facilities, safety, and the quality team on-site in Grayling, MI. Responsibilities will include: Perform the receipt, storage, movement, inventory, and shipment of HAZMAT Class 1 Explosives, following all applicable regulations, including DOW, DOT, ATF, and NFPA 495 guidelines. Receive, stock, and maintain incoming inventory from vendors. Pick, kit, and deliver inventory items to the production floor. Perform all required transactions within Oracle. Perform internal and inter-company movement of materials. Investigate and resolve discrepancies identified during cycle counts. Perform UPS and FedEx shipments using online shipping systems. Perform kitting, crate preparation, packing, and coordinating with freight forwarders on larger shipments. Complete all domestic and international shipping paperwork. Ensure compliance with government export regulations on international shipments. Prepare and maintain records of merchandise shipped, including posting weights and shipping charges. Examine, stock, and distribute materials in inventory and on manufacturing lines. Prepare kitting packages for assembly production as required. Safely and efficiently use hand tools, hand trucks, and forklifts. Strict adherence to all company policies, procedures, safety regulations, and applicable federal, state, and local laws at all times. Maintain full accountability of explosive assets through accurate inventory control, documentation, and secure storage.
